How to fill out warranty deed by limited

01
Start by obtaining a copy of the warranty deed form specific to your jurisdiction.
02
Read through the form carefully to understand the required fields and sections.
03
Gather all necessary information related to the limited warranty deed, such as property details and the names of parties involved.
04
Begin by filling out the heading section, which typically includes the name of the state, county, and the date of the deed.
05
Identify the grantor (the person or entity transferring the property) and provide their full legal name and address.
06
Identify the grantee (the person or entity receiving the property) and provide their full legal name and address.
07
Describe the property being transferred accurately, including its complete legal description and address.
08
Clearly state the consideration or payment involved in the transfer, if any.
09
Include any relevant encumbrances or exceptions to the warranty being provided, such as liens or easements.
10
Sign the warranty deed in the presence of a notary public and ensure all required parties also sign the document.
11
Submit the completed warranty deed to the appropriate county recorder or office responsible for recording property documents.
12
Keep a copy of the executed warranty deed for your records.

A warranty deed by limited is a legal document used to transfer ownership of real property with limited warranty, which guarantees the grantee that the grantor holds title to the property and has the right to convey it, but limits the scope of the warranty to the period during which the grantor owned the property.
Typically, the grantor, or the person transferring the property, is required to file the warranty deed by limited with the appropriate local government office, such as the county recorder or clerk's office.
To fill out a warranty deed by limited, include details such as the names of the grantor and grantee, the description of the property, the limited warranty language, the date of transfer, and the signatures of the parties involved. It may also need to be notarized.
The purpose of a warranty deed by limited is to provide a level of assurance to the grantee regarding the title of the property while limiting the grantor's liability for any title defects that may arise from prior ownership.
The warranty deed by limited must include the names of the parties, a legal description of the property, the type of deed (limited), any encumbrances or liens, signatures, and acknowledgement by a notary public.
